Great plot size, plenty of character and ample living accommodation means this bungalow should not be missed. The breakfast kitchen provides a great family space along with three good size double bedrooms and additional space upstairs. There is a large private garden to rear with double garage and driveway.
EPC Grade = E

Entrance Hall

Double glazed door to front with two stained glass window panels to either side, under stairs storage cupboard, two radiators, wall light points.

Lounge

12' 10" x 15' 2"  (3.92m x 4.61m) Bay window with encased stained glass panels at the top, feature fire set in surround, radiator, two wall light points, coving to ceiling.

Dining Room

11' 11" x 11' 10"  (3.63m x 3.6m) Double glazed window to side, double doors to breakfast kitchen, radiator.

Kitchen

Double glazed window to rear, fitted wall and base units with complimenting work surfaces, breakfast bar, space for washing machine, integral dishwasher, gas hob, electric oven, single sink and drainer unit, boiler housed in cupboard. Door to:

Rear Porch

Panelled with double glazed door to rear.

Bedroom One

13' 2" x 13' 6"  (4m x 4.1m) Could be used as a reception room if needed, double glazed bay window to front with encased panels, two double glazed stained glass picture windows to side, radiator, coving to ceiling

Bedroom Two

12' 9" x 14' 0"  (3.89m x 4.28m) Double glazed window to side and rear, radiator.

Bedroom Three

9' 7" x 10' 2"  (2.91m x 3.1m) Double glazed window to rear, radiator.

Bathroom

Three piece suite comprising low level WC, wash hand basin with storage under, bath with shower over and screen, part tiled walls, radiator.

WC

Double glazed window to side, low level WC.

Upstairs Space

Stairs from hallway, access to storage in eaves, double glazed window to front, boarded and carpeted with lighting. Could be used as bedroom subject to local planning and building regulations.

Garage

Double garage with electric up and over doors.

External

To the front of the property is a lawn area and driveway to side leading to garage. To the rear of the property is a generous lawn, fence enclosed and very private, there are mature plant and shrub borders with hard standing concrete area.
